Took a little time off from studying to get my card ready for Papertrey Ink’s June Blog Hop Challenge. I originally wanted to do some ribbon pleating, but it didn’t quite work out for me.

I chose to work the the same color palette from the inspiration photo and did some floral stamping.

Floral Thanks

Floral Thanks - Close Up

Supplies:
Cardstock: PTI (Rustic White)
Stamps: PTI (Rosie Posie, Inside & Out: Thank You)
Ink: PTI (Simply Chartreuse) Impress (Mango, Chamomile, Mojito)
Other: PTI (Harvest Gold Bitty Dot Satin Ribbon) American Crafts (ribbon) Rinestones (crystal, green)
